Sat 793026972775510

decimal
158605.1972775510
degree
0°158605′1357″1972775510‴
percentile
37.76318922132572%
name
ifrpoikgxax
cycle
0
epoch
0
period
78
block
158605
offset
1972775510
timestamp
rarity
common